Transport Options

Traveling from Polokwane to Manzini offers several transportation options tailored to different preferences. The quickest way is by flight, taking approximately 1 hour, but availability may vary. For those seeking a budget-friendly choice, taking a bus is a viable option, with travel times ranging from 6 to 8 hours. Alternatively, driving a car provides flexibility and the chance to explore the scenic route, typically taking around 5 hours. For business travelers or those on a tight schedule, flying is recommended, while leisure travelers may enjoy the immersive experience of a bus ride or a scenic drive.
